什么是数字钱包签名?

数字钱包签名是一种使用加密算法的技术,旨在确保信息在传输过程中不被篡改,并验证信息的发送者身份。在数字钱包环境中,每一笔交易都需要经过签名才能被网络接受。这一过程确保了交易的可靠性与安全性,其核心在于公钥和私钥的配对。

私钥是一个秘密信息,仅由钱包的持有者知晓,用于生成交易的数字签名。而公钥则是可以公开的,用于验证签名。处于安全考虑,拥有私钥的人可以创建有效的交易,而任何人都可以使用公钥验证这些交易的真实性。

数字钱包签名的运作机制

全面解析数字钱包签名:安全性、运作机制与最佳实践

数字钱包签名的运作机制可以简述为以下几个步骤:

  1. 生成密钥对:在创建数字钱包时,用户会生成一对密钥:私钥和公钥。私钥用于创建签名,公钥则用于验证签名。
  2. 发起交易:用户在数字钱包中选择要进行的交易(如转账),并输入相关信息。
  3. 生成签名:钱包软件会通过私钥对交易信息进行加密,生成交易的数字签名。
  4. 广播交易:将交易信息及签名一起发送到区块链网络,供矿工进行验证。
  5. 验证签名:矿工或网络节点使用公钥对数字签名进行验证,确保交易的有效性。
  6. 添加到区块链:如果签名有效,交易将被记录到区块链中,完成交易过程。

数字钱包签名的安全性是否可靠?

数字钱包签名的安全性在很大程度上依赖于加密算法的强度及用户对私钥的保护。现代加密技术,如椭圆曲线加密(ECC)和RSA,加上适当的密钥长度,提供了很高的安全性。

然而,用户必须注意保护私钥。若私钥被泄露,攻击者可轻易伪造交易,造成资金损失。因此,用户应使用安全的存储方式,如硬件钱包或冷存储。同时,要定期备份私钥,并利用两步验证(2FA)等额外的安全手段。

另外,选择信誉良好的数字钱包服务提供商,确保其在安全性和隐私方面有良好的记录,也是保障安全的重要一步。定期更新钱包软件,以修补潜在的漏洞和提升安全性也是最佳实践之一。

数字钱包签名的技术挑战

全面解析数字钱包签名:安全性、运作机制与最佳实践

虽然数字钱包签名技术已经相当成熟,但仍面临一些技术挑战。这些挑战包括密钥管理、算法过时、以及软硬件的安全性等。

首先,密钥管理是一个重大的挑战。用户容易因未妥善保存私钥而导致资产损失。此外,智能合约和去中心化金融(DeFi)的普及使得用户面临更多的安全风险,攻击者很可能利用合约漏洞获得用户资产。

其次,随着计算能力的提升,一些原先安全的加密算法可能会变得不再安全。例如,在量子计算出现后,现有的加密算法可能会受到威胁。因此,开发更强大的算法以及量子安全的加密技术是未来的一个研究重点。

最后,数字钱包本身的软硬件也可能成为安全漏洞。用户应该选择经过验证的软件和硬件,提高自我防护能力。同时,厂商应不断提高产品的安全性,通过定期更新和风险评估来加强保护。

用户在使用数字钱包签名时的最佳实践

为了保障数字钱包签名的安全性,用户应遵循一些最佳实践:

  1. 使用强密码和双重认证:设置复杂的密码,并启用双重认证功能,增加额外的安全层。
  2. 保护私钥:确保私钥仅存储在安全的位置,避免将其保存在云端或未加密的设备上。
  3. 定期备份:定期备份钱包文件和私钥,以防止数据丢失。
  4. 保持软件更新:及时更新数字钱包软件,修补潜在的安全漏洞。
  5. 警惕钓鱼攻击:时刻保持警惕,避免点击可疑链接,确保只通过合法渠道访问钱包。
  6. 使用硬件钱包:对于存储大量加密资产的用户,考虑使用硬件钱包以提高安全性。

用户在使用数字钱包签名方面可能遇到的问题

1. 如何找回丢失的私钥?
丢失私钥通常意味着无法访问相应的加密资产。除非此前进行过备份,否则找回丢失的私钥几乎不可能。建议用户在创建钱包时,立即进行私钥的备份,并妥善保管。如果用户使用的是托管钱包服务,可能可以通过提供个人信息或验证身份的方式寻求帮助。

2. 数字签名失败的原因是什么?
造成数字签名失败的原因主要包括私钥错误、交易信息篡改、以及网络问题等。在发起交易时,如果用户输入了错误的私钥,交易将无法有效签名。若交易信息在广播期间被篡改,签名验证将失败。此外,网络问题也可能导致交易未能正确被发送或确认,应确保网络良好。

3. 如何选择合适的数字钱包?
选择数字钱包时,用户应考虑多个因素,如安全性、易用性、支持的数字资产种类以及社区反馈等。硬件钱包因其安全性高而受到推荐,而在线钱包则因其便捷而受欢迎。始终推荐用户在选择之前做充分的调研,了解其安全措施和用户评价。

4. 如何避免数字钱包被黑客攻击?
黑客攻击的常见方式包括恶意软件、网络钓鱼以及社交工程攻击等。用户应采取有效的防护措施,例如使用高强度的密码和双重认证、定期检查账户活动、在不安全的网络环境下禁止任何交易操作,以及保持软件的最新状态等。此外,用户应谨慎对待来自不明来源的信息和链接,以减少被攻击的风险。

以上内容提供了对数字钱包签名的全面解析,涵盖了基本概念、运作机制、安全性、技术挑战及最佳实践。如果你对此领域有进一步关注的问题或想法,请随时联系。